London, United Kingdom, September 2025 – Lawhive has appointed Matt Doe as its new Head of Talent. In this role, Matt will lead talent strategy and recruitment as the company leverages AI to transform consumer law and make legal services more accessible. His mandate includes building scalable hiring frameworks, strengthening employer branding, and driving executive and global talent acquisition to support Lawhive’s rapid growth.

Matt joins Lawhive from Carwow, where he served as Head of Talent Acquisition for just over a year. Joining after the company’s Series E funding round, he managed a global team of nine talent professionals, overseeing significant headcount growth from 500 to 700 employees. He restructured the team to emphasize sourcing and business partnership, implemented advanced talent acquisition systems such as Ashby and Metaview, reduced average time-to-fill from three months to one, and played a central role in executive hiring and organizational workforce planning.

Prior to Carwow, Matt spent four years at hyperexponential as Head of Talent. Joining at seed stage as employee #11 and the first Talent/People hire, he built the talent function from the ground up, scaling the company to around 200 employees across London, New York, and Warsaw through post-Series B. He established hyperexponential as an employer of choice, introduced early career frameworks, and led a team of seven across talent acquisition and operations.

Previously, Matt co-founded TalentBase, a specialist talent and people consultancy designed to support high-growth tech scaleups. Over three and a half years, he partnered with organizations such as G-Research, ITV, Sainsbury’s, JustEat, and Eigen Technologies, leading people and talent strategies through periods of intense growth.

His earlier career included leadership roles at ThinkersConnect, where he scaled Ve Global from 50 to 500 employees, and consultancy experience with PCR Digital and Arrows Group, where he specialized in recruiting top software engineering talent. These roles gave him a strong foundation in technology recruitment, people strategy, and organizational design.

About Lawhive

Lawhive is revolutionizing the legal industry by combining an SRA-licensed and regulated law firm with a cutting-edge AI-powered platform. Based in the UK, the company is backed by leading investors such as Google Ventures, TQ Ventures, Balderton, Episode 1, and high-profile supporters including Premier League footballers Harry Maguire and Reece James.

Lawhive’s mission is to make legal services more efficient, affordable, and accessible, while reimagining the legal profession for both consumers and practitioners. With regular appearances at SRA events and guidance from industry experts like former SRA executive director Crispin Passmore, Lawhive is positioned at the forefront of legal innovation.

Matthew Breitfelder is Partner and Global Head of Human Capital at Apollo, where he focuses on attracting extraordinary talent to the firm and creating an innovative, inclusive, high-performance culture that brings out the best in Apollo’s people. Matt leads Apollo’s recruiting, talent management, compensation, succession planning, citizenship, employee relations, development, and culture work. He is also a member of the firm’s Leadership Team. Matt is committed to expanding opportunities across Apollo’s workplace, marketplace, and communities. Prior to joining Apollo, Matt was Chief Talent Officer at BlackRock as well as a member of the Operating Committee. Previously, he held strategy, talent, and innovation roles at Mastercard, PwC, and CEB/Gartner.

Matt holds a BA in Economics from the University of Southern California, an MSc from the London School of Economics, and an MBA from Harvard Business School. He currently serves on the boards of the Lumina Foundation, the Aspen Institute’s Business and Society program, the Milken Institute’s Inclusive Capitalism initiative, and Georgetown University’s initiative on AI, Analytics, and the Future of Work. He is the co-author of numerous Harvard Business School case studies and articles on leadership. Matt has been recognized as a Top Global CHRO multiple times by n2Growth and Stanford Business School.
